Customer Service Representative 

A customer service representative is a great option for disabled jobseekers in the UK. The role involves interacting with customers and providing them with information about products and services. It is a desk-based job that can be done from home, which means it is perfect for people who need to work around their physical disabilities. Customer service representatives need to have excellent communication skills and be able to handle difficult customer enquiries.  

Data Entry Clerk 

A data entry clerk is another great option for disabled jobseekers in the UK. The role involves entering data into a computer system, which can be done from home or in an office, giving you great flexibility. Data entry clerks need to have good attention to detail and be able to type quickly and accurately.  

Transcriptionist 

A transcriptionist is a great option for disabled jobseekers looking for desk jobs in the UK. The role involves transcribing audio files into written text, which can be done from home or in an office. Transcriptionists need to have good listening skills and be able to type quickly and accurately.  

Virtual Assistant 

Another great option for disabled jobseekers looking for desk jobs is a role as a virtual assistant. The role involves providing administrative support to clients, which can be done from home or in an office. Virtual assistants need to have excellent organisational skills and be able to handle a variety of tasks.  

Proofreader 

Becoming a proof-reader is a great option for disabled jobseekers to consider. The role involves reading and correcting text, which can be done from home or in an office. Proof-readers need to have excellent attention to detail and be able to identify errors.  

Telemarketer 

A telemarketer is a great option for disabled jobseekers in the UK. The role involves making sales calls to potential customers, which can be done from home or in an office. Telemarketers need to have excellent communication skills and be very persuasive.  

Market Research Analyst 

A market research analyst is a great option for disabled jobseekers searching for desk jobs in the UK. The role involves conducting research and analysis, which can be done from home or in an office. Market research analysts need to have excellent analytical skills and be able to interpret data.  

Web Developer 

A web developer is another great option for disabled jobseekers in the UK. The role involves developing and designing websites, which can be done from home or in an office. Web developers need to have good technical skills and be able to understand user needs.
